Where Python is used. (The use of Python)

  • Web development (Django, Flask)
  • Data science (Pandas, NumPy)
  • Machine learning and AI (TensorFlow, Scikit-learn)
  • The use of cyber security tools
  • Mobile and desktop applications.
  • The development of the game
  • The use of IoT devices
  •  Education and Teaching.

How Python works. How does this language work?

When you write code in a Python, it is understandable to humans. But it is the computers and only understands binary like (0 and 1). To fill this gap, Python follows a few steps:

 

1. writing the source code.

You can be writes a Pythons code in a .py file.

 

2. The Role of the Interpreter

Python is an interpreted language. This means that the code is read line-by-line and run at the same time. This method helps in easy debugging many times.

 

3. Translation into Byte Code

Python’s code is first converted to “bytecode” – a form that the virtual machine can read. The Pythons Virtual Machine (PVM) executes this bytecode and its displays the output on the  your screen. The whole process is a smart mix of compiler and interpreter. That is why Python is considered to be powerful yet flexible. read more…..
